Better Compaction

Compaction ratios are often used to compare and sell compactors, but buyers must beware that compaction ratios are not a perfect science and can fluctuate dramatically. Dense material (lumber, telephone books, etc.) will not compact very well compared to shredded paper or cardboard. Therefore, it will have a low compaction ratio regardless of the type of compactor in use. It is a combination of the machine and material that determines the compaction ratio. 

Sani-Tech Augers pre-crush the waste material, changing its size and shape (which ram style hydraulic compactors don't do) prior to it entering the bin. Our design produces compaction ratios that outperforms other commercial trash compactors by 50%. The Auger method will always achieve higher compaction ratios than a ram style hydraulic compactor. 

All Electric Rotary Drive

Sani-Tech Auger Compactors are all electric, eliminating hydraulic oils, contamination, filters, reservoirs, line breaks, leaks, and maintenance. This system delivers robust power while remaining quiet and will run the same regardless of the ambient temperature. Our all electric rotary drive remains reliable, efficient, eco-friendly and ensures a clean operation all around. Faster

Sani-Tech's rotating Auger is always moving forward, eliminating the need to consider cycle times and charge box capacity. Continuous material feeding through their seamless forward operation eliminates any wait time required for crushing. Ram hydraulic compactors use retracting cycles that result in a much longer process. Sanitary

Auger Compactors and attached bins (self-contained and stationary compactors) are 100% sealed. No scavengers or people can get into the hopper or container because of the auger and nozzle that penetrates the container. Upon separation for stationary models, very little material falls out of the container by virtue of the elevated round opening of the auger nozzle. When our Auger Compactor is compared to the large rectangular opening of the ram compactors, spillage is minimal!

Efficient Operation

Material can be fed into the Auger much faster than a ram system since there is no cycle time. Labor is reduced (on manual feed systems) since operators do not need to wait for the Compactor to cycle and re-fill the charge box. Sani-Tech Augers are smaller because there is no hydraulic ram pistoning back and forth.

Full Container

The ram style hydraulic compactors do little to change the size and shape of material before bin insertion. This can result in the top portion of a container remaining empty and the material being packed so tight that workers must climb into the container or use pre-laid cables to pull the material out, which is a major safety hazard! With a Sani-Tech Auger, you can avoid this situation because it pre-crushes and blends the material during processing. Our bins are consistently full and always empty without human intervention

Less Maintenance

The only routine maintenance on an Auger Compactor is main bearing lubrication. By using the Automatic Lubricator, even this requirement is minimizedWith fewer moving parts and no hydraulic systems, they significantly reduce downtime and servicing needs, making them a cost-effective and hassle-free choice for waste management operations. Increased Safety

Ram style hydraulic compactors often jam from material "bouncing back" into the charge box. This material gets wedged underneath and behind the ram, requiring a person to climb into the charge box or dismantle the ram container to remove the material. Our Auger Compactors completely eliminate this circumstance, continuously moving refuse and recycling into the bin! You can rest assured your operators won't need to risk their safety in order to fix a jam. This robust design also eliminates the risk of hydraulic leaks and spills, further reducing the potential for workplace accidents and environmental hazards.
